Wind Creek Names New Marketing Director for Aruba, Curacao Resorts

By: Caribbean Journal Staff - August 9, 2022

Wind Creek Hospitality has named a new director of sales and marketing for its Aruba and Curacao resorts, Caribbean Journal has learned. 

The company has tapped Janien Huistra to the role; Huistra had been serving as sales and marketing director for the Renaissance Wind Creek Aruba Resort, and has now added Curacao to her portfolio. 

“Janien is an extremely talented and driven hospitality professional, and her experience in sales and marketing coupled with her innovative thinking makes her a phenomenal addition to the team,” says Maylin Trenidad, Managing Director at Renaissance Wind Creek Curaçao Resort. “Renaissance Curaçao and Wind Creek’s growing Caribbean presence will benefit from Janien’s proven industry instincts and innovative approach to the everchanging hospitality landscape.”

Janien Huistra, Director of Sales & Marketing at Renaissance Wind Creek Aruba and Curaçao Resorts

Huistra helped open the Curacao resort back in 2008.

“I am very excited to lead both Renaissance Curaçao and Renaissance Aruba in my larger role within Wind Creek Hospitality,” Huistra said. “My experience with both resorts and my tenure with the company has prepared me for this dual-directorship and I look forward to maximizing the strength of both teams moving forward.”
